What Exactly Is 24 Gauge Galvanized Wire?

So, let’s break it down simply. “24 gauge” refers to the wire’s thickness, standardized by American Wire Gauge (AWG). Being “galvanized” means the core metal (steel or iron) has a protective zinc layer to resist rust and corrosion. This thin, zinc-metal combo ensures strength with flexibility, making it ideal for fencing, wire mesh, cable reinforcement, and even craftwork.

Key Aspects of 24 Gauge Galvanized Wire

Durability

The zinc coating prevents oxidation even in damp or salty environments, extending the wire’s life span — often up to 30 years under normal outdoor conditions. Many engineers say this longevity offsets slightly higher upfront costs compared to uncoated wire.

Flexibility & Strength

Despite its thin gauge, this wire balances tensile strength with some bending ease — perfect for applications needing shaping without snapping.

Cost Efficiency

Compared to stainless steel or other exotic alloys, galvanized wire offers a cost-effective solution while maintaining essential protective qualities.

Scalability

Available in spools or custom lengths, it adapts to large industrial projects or small artisanal uses alike.

Environmental Resistance

The zinc layer helps the wire stand up well against UV exposure and acid rain, which is why it works remarkably well in various climates.

Product Specification Table

Specification Detail
Gauge 24 (AWG)
Diameter 0.0201 inches (0.511 mm)
Material Steel core with zinc galvanization
Coating Thickness Typically 10-15 microns
Tensile Strength Up to 300 MPa
Standard Lengths Available in spools (e.g., 50m to 500m)

Challenges & Solutions

Despite its benefits, 24 gauge galvanized wire isn’t bulletproof. For example, scratches or abrasions on the zinc layer can cause rust spots in high-salinity areas — a common frustration. Many engineers recommend using thicker coatings or supplementing with PVC coating in sensitive environments.

FAQ: Common Questions About 24 Gauge Galvanized Wire

  • How does 24 gauge galvanized wire compare with stainless steel wire?
    Galvanized wire is more cost-effective and offers sufficient corrosion resistance for many applications, whereas stainless steel wire is more durable but also pricier—often reserved for highly corrosive environments.
  • What industries benefit most from 24 gauge galvanized wire?
    Construction, agriculture, fencing, disaster relief, and electrical applications are top sectors relying on it for its balance of protection and affordability.
  • Can galvanized wire be welded or soldered?
    Welding can damage the zinc coating, so it’s generally avoided. Soldering is possible but requires care to maintain corrosion resistance.
  • Is galvanized wire recyclable?
    Yes, the steel core and zinc can be recycled, supporting sustainability goals in manufacturing and waste management.
